Transaction 00334c608d2034421c56fc4f851e66e86b389974f562f27fc31bc61c0288edaa
1 Input
1 Output
-
00334c608d2034421c56fc4f851e66e86b389974f562f27fc31bc61c0288edaa:0
- value
- 33661052
- script pubkey
- OP_0 OP_PUSHBYTES_20 21629c9d7b0b7fde0677bdfeb5e25fb049ba9759
- address
- bc1qy93fe8tmpdlaupnhhhlttcjlkpym496er7qqmy